Warning Signs You Need Hydrostatic Pressure Water Removal

Ignoring the warning signs of hydrostatic pressure water damage can lead to costly repairs and even safety hazards. Be aware of these common indicators and take action before it’s too late.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

If you notice a persistent, unpleasant smell in your home, it may be a sign of hidden water damage. Don’t ignore this warning sign, it could be a sign of a larger issue.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

If your flooring is warping, buckling, or sagging, it’s likely a result of excess moisture. This can lead to costly repairs and even safety hazards.

Cracks in Walls or Ceilings

Cracks in your walls or ceilings can be a sign of hydrostatic pressure water damage. Don’t ignore these warning signs, they can lead to further damage and safety hazards.

Water Stains or Discoloration

Unexplained water stains or discoloration on your walls or ceilings can be a sign of hidden water damage. Take action before it’s too late.

Efflorescence or Salt Deposits

White or off-white deposits on your walls or floors can be a sign of efflorescence, caused by the presence of salt deposits from water damage. Don’t ignore this warning sign, it could be a sign of a larger issue.

Hydrostatic Pressure Water Removal Cost In San Juan Capistrano, CA

The cost of hydrostatic pressure water removal in San Juan Capistrano, CA can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. These estimates are based on real-world costs and can vary depending on your specific situation.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Initial Inspection and Assessment $200 – $500 Severity of damage, size of affected area
Water Extraction $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, equipment needed
Drying and Dehumidification $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, equipment needed
Cleaning and Sanitizing $200 – $1,000 Size of affected area, equipment needed
Final Inspection and Repair $200 – $1,000 Size of affected area, equipment needed
More Services (e.g., mold remediation) $1,000 – $5,000 Severity of damage, size of affected area

Keep in mind that these estimates are based on real-world costs and can vary depending on your specific situation. We’ll provide a detailed estimate after assessing the damage and developing a customized plan to address your needs.
